The interview process had 3 rounds. First, a round with the Recruitment team. Then, a technical interview with the director. Finally, another interview with the manager. The people were very nice, they were from Europe, but the project was based in the USA. It wasn't too hard if you have prior experience.

Confirmed questions1 question
  • Could you elaborate on your QA process?

I was introduced to the role by a recruiter and the process was quick. It started with a call with HR to go over basic info and ask about salary range. Then, I had an interview with the Hiring Manager where we got a bit deeper into the role and my resume. Finally, I had an in-office interview with the Hiring Manager and the CFO.

Confirmed questions1 question
  • Can you describe a past project and its company impact?
